服务器集群架构是现代互联网应用中实现高可用性和扩展性的关键技术。通过将多个服务器组合成一个整体,集群能够提供更高的计算能力和冗余保障,确保服务在部分节点故障时仍能正常运行。
在实际部署中,服务器集群通常由负载均衡器进行调度。负载均衡器作为入口点,负责将客户端请求合理分配到后端各个服务器上,避免单点过载,同时提升整体响应效率。
高效的负载均衡策略需要考虑多种因素,如服务器的当前负载、响应时间、地理位置等。常见的算法包括轮询、加权轮询、最少连接数和基于性能的动态分配。选择合适的策略可以显著提升系统的稳定性和用户体验。
AI绘图结果,仅供参考
除了算法选择,负载均衡器还应具备健康检查机制,定期检测后端服务器的状态,自动剔除异常节点,确保流量只流向正常运行的服务器。这种自我修复能力是集群高可用性的关键保障。
•随着业务增长,集群可能需要动态扩展。通过自动化工具和云原生技术,系统可以根据实时需求自动增减服务器实例,实现资源的最优利用。
总体而言,服务器集群与负载均衡的结合不仅提升了系统的可靠性,也为大规模应用提供了灵活的扩展路径,是构建现代高性能服务的重要基础。